A book club edition bce or book of the month club edition bomc refers to a book printed by a book club with cheaper materials than the original publishing house, and is generally not worth much to the serious collector. Book club is a 2018 american romantic comedy film directed by bill holderman, in his directorial debut, and written by holderman and erin simms.
